The Italian Carabinieri are fed up with Alfa Romeo Tonale. Alfa Romeo is also fed up with the Carabinieri

For many of us, the car is a means of transport and a pleasure when traveling. For security forces, cars They are essential tools In your day to day. Sometimes, also a nightmare, as is the case with the Alfa Romeo Tonale owned by the Carabinieri -the Italian counterpart of the Civil Guard-.

And a scandal so large has been mounted that Alfa Romeo threatens to denounce the Carabinieri if they continue to stain their image.

Historical relationship. If you have ever been in Italy, you have surely seen that the Alfa Romeo are the cars of the security forces. It has also been seen in films. This relationship It comes from afarof the 50s, to be exact. The security forces needed fast cars and the Alfa Romeo were the chosen ones. Alfa Romeo 1900 became the vehicle of both the police and the Carabinieri.

They were fast, agile and easy to drive, which made them ideal cars for that police work. Over the years, fleets have been renewed with new models, some high performance. But in 2023 it was the turn that a SUV occupied the police garages next to the imposing Giulia Quadrifoglio.

The tonale. To the Alfa Romeo Tonale Things are not going well. This SUV did not start well in the market due to Poor sales. It is a car designed to enjoy driving quietly, without being nervous and enjoying a powerful infotainment system. And these concepts are not aligned with police requirements.

In June 2023, however, 400 Alfa Romeo Tonale in its hybrid version of 163 hp with 1.5 engine and automatic change were delivered to the Carabinieri. They had been modified with lights, siren, partial armor, police radio and detainee cell, but the motorization is not the most powerful that can be chosen in that family.

THE JALEO. They were definitely not happy. This May, the union union that represents part of the Carabinieri has presented a formal complaint Before the prosecutor of the repubblica of Rome alleging that the Tonale is inappropriate for the police service. Your arguments? It is a car with stability problems and road behavior, especially in emergency situations such as high -speed persecutions, does not grab well and the step is not safe on unstable roads.

This puts both the safety of the agents and the effectiveness of the missions, but the complaints do not stay there. UNARMA continues to argue cannot “accept that colleagues work in potentially dangerous conditions” and that “it is the duty of the administration to guarantee safe, reliable and fully appropriate vehicles to the operational demands.”

And Stellantis response. Imagine being the brand behind the creation of a car that came to relive a not very prolific segment that runs from Bruces with a security body that will squeeze the car saying that it is unstable and not sure. Well what the brand has done is … counterattack. In a releaseAlfa Romeo responded with the following official note:

“Our vehicles comply with the strictest safety standards and are subject to rigorous evaluation tests. Alfa Romeo remains completely available to the authorities for any clarification and reserves the right to defend their image and reputation before the competent bodies.”

In the rest of the note they limit themselves to reviewing that historical relationship between the brand and the Carabinieri. In the end, it is a morrocotudo mess that stains a 75 -year relationship that has contributed to that good image of the Alfa Romeo in their native country. But something important here is that, from the brand’s porpholio, the tonale is cheaper than the Stelvio, another SUV, and much more than the giulia (both the standard and the quadrifoglio preferred by the Carabinieri).

We will see what happens, since the National Secretary of Unarma ends the statement stating that they will not stop “until everything that happened is clarified.”
